Michigan completes record month for internet gaming18 April 2023
In March 2023, The Mitten State brought in $171.8 million, surpassing the previous total gross receipts record of $153.7 million set earlier this year.

Detroit casinos report $119.2 million in March 2023 monthly aggregate revenue11 April 2023
Table games and slots at the three Detroit casinos generated $117.8 million in revenue, and retail sports betting produced $1.4 million in revenue.

Detroit casinos generate $105.5 million in revenue for February13 March 2023
Table games and slots generated $105 million in revenue, while retail sports betting produced $458,752.

Detroit casinos report $103.5 million in January revenue15 February 2023
The three Detroit casinos reported $103.5 million in monthly aggregate revenue in January. Table games and slots generated $103.4 million in revenue while retail sports betting produced $111,023.
MGCB approves 888 Holdings as Hannahville tribe’s internet casino gaming provider7 February 2023
The Michigan Gaming Control Board came to this decision after the original provider Twin Spires exited the business last year.
Changes to Michigan laws provide stronger funding sources for the state2 February 2023
Charitable millionaire party fundraisers will now be funded by the Internet Gaming Fund, which will provide a more sustainable source of revenue.
NCPG releases US Online Responsible Gaming Regulations report31 January 2023
The National Council on Problem Gambling's document finds that regulations in four of the seven states where iGaming is legal fall drastically short.

BetMGM awarded players over $100 million in jackpots in 202223 January 2023
BetMGM awarded the highest total of jackpot prize money in Michigan ($38.3 million), followed by BetMGM New Jersey ($30.2 million), and Pennsylvania ($28.9 million).

Michigan records $1.98 billion total gross for 202223 January 2023
Commercial and tribal internet casino gaming and sports betting operators reported gross receipts rose 41% from 2021.
The Sault Ste. Marie Tribe of Chippewa Indians seeks relief from court ruling16 January 2023
The Michigan judge ruled that the tribe repay $88 million in damages to the developers of the proposed casinos in Lansing and Romulus.
